Baroli Ghata Population - Chittaurgarh, Rajasthan

Baroli Ghata is a medium size village located in Nimbahera Tehsil of Chittaurgarh district, Rajasthan with total 340 families residing. The Baroli Ghata village has population of 1499 of which 758 are males while 741 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Baroli Ghata village population of children with age 0-6 is 182 which makes up 12.14 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Baroli Ghata village is 978 which is higher than Rajasthan state average of 928. Child Sex Ratio for the Baroli Ghata as per census is 896, higher than Rajasthan average of 888.

Baroli Ghata village has lower literacy rate compared to Rajasthan. In 2011, literacy rate of Baroli Ghata village was 63.17 % compared to 66.11 % of Rajasthan. In Baroli Ghata Male literacy stands at 82.78 % while female literacy rate was 43.36 %.

Caste Factor

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 19.28 % while Schedule Tribe (ST) were 13.54 % of total population in Baroli Ghata village.

Work Profile

In Baroli Ghata village out of total population, 951 were engaged in work activities. 99.89 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 0.11 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 951 workers engaged in Main Work, 806 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 100 were Agricultural labourer.
